php数组转换json字符串的方法:首先创建一个php示例文件;然后定义一组数组数据;最后通过“json_encode($color)”方法将数组转换成json字符串即可。

PHP中 数组/对象转成JSON字符串

代码如下:<?php

//php语言生成json字符串

//json_encode(数组/对象);

//① 索引数组-->JavaScript数组

$color = array('gold','yellow','blue');

echo json_encode($color)."
";// ["gold","yellow","blue"]

//② 关联数组-->json字符串

$city = array('shandong'=>'jinan','henan'=>'zhengzhou','hebei'=>'shijiazhuang');

echo json_encode($city)."
";//{"shandong":"jinan","henan":"zhengzhou","hebei":"shijiazhuang"}

//③ 索引关联数组-->json字符串

$city2 = array('shandong'=>'jinan','henan'=>'zhengzhou','shenyang','hebei'=>'shijiazhuang');

echo json_encode($city2)."
";//{"shandong":"jinan","henan":"zhengzhou","0":"shenyang","hebei":"shijiazhuang"}

//④ 对象生成json信息-->json字符串

// (只会序列化"成员属性",不会序列化"成员方法")

class Person{

//类内部的成员属性需要有修饰符(var/public/protected/private),其是固定语法

public $color = "yellow";

var $height = 170;

function run(){

echo "is running";

}

}

$tom = new Person();

echo json_encode($tom); //{"color":"yellow","height":170}

php将数组转化成json字符串,php数组如何转换json字符串相关推荐

  1. python 如何将字符串列表合并后转换成字符串? ''.join(List(str))函数

    参考文章:python 怎么将列表转换成字符串 temp_list = ['h', 'e', 'l', 'l', 'o'] result = ''.join(temp_list) print(resu ...

  2. python json()是什么函数_python 处理 json 四个函数dumps、loads、dump、load的区别

    1 .json.dumps() 函数是将一个 Python 数据类型列表(可以理解为字典)进行json格式的编码(转换成字符串,用于传播) eg, dict = {"age": & ...

  3. php把变量转换为字符串,php如何将变量转换成字符串

    [摘要] PHP即"超文本预处理器",是一种通用开源脚本语言.PHP是在服务器端执行的脚本语言,与C语言类似,是常用的网站编程语言.PHP独特的语法混合了C.Java.Perl以及 ...

  4. [转载] Python将列表转换成字符串及字符串左右中对齐输出问题

    参考链接: Python 字符串中的字符串对齐 将列表转换成字符串 a = ['h','e','l','l','o'] b = ''.join(a) print(a) print(b) 运行结果: [ ...

  5. oracle json字符串转数组,json字符串转化成json对象(原生方法)

    json字符串.json对象.数组 三者之间的转换 //json字符串.json对象.数组 三者之间的转换 let jsonStr = '[{"id":"01" ...

  6. json字符串、json对象、数组 三者之间的转换

    json字符串转化成json对象 // jquery的方法 var jsonObj = $.parseJSON(jsonStr) //js 的方法 var jsonObj = JSON.parse(j ...

  7. json字符串、json对象、数组之间的转换

    记录一下 json字符串转化成json对象 // jquery的方法 var jsonObj = $.parseJSON(jsonStr) //js 的方法 var jsonObj = JSON.pa ...

  8. json c语言 数组转字符串数组中,json和字符串/数组/集合的互相转换の神操作总结...

    一:前端字符串转JSON的4种方式 1,eval方式解析,恐怕这是最早的解析方式了. function strToJson(str){ var json = eval('(' + str + ')') ...

  9. Vue前后台数据交互实例演示,使用axios传递json字符串、数组

    Vue 前后台数据交互实例演示 第一章:后台实现 ① Python 启用 Flask 服务器 ② 后台启用成功验证 第二章:前台实现 ① Vue 使用 Axios 实现接收 json 字符串.数组数据 ...

最新文章

  1. LeetCode(7.整数反转)JAVA
  2. 使用SAP Analytics Cloud显示全球新冠肺炎确诊人数和发展趋势的预测
  3. linux树形目录结构存放,Linux目录结构
  4. DW —— 简易计算器 (JavaScript)
  5. 访问HDFS报错:org.apache.hadoop.security.AccessControlException: Permission denied
  6. [转载]使用Java将Word转为Html或txt!
  7. 竞拍系统c语言,C++版扫拍卖源代码,非程序,这下不会删帖吧?
  8. Linux网页版操作
  9. 计算机数学基础⑤(Graphs)
  10. 应用宝shangjia安全评估报告_你的APP上架,遇到【安全评估报告】这道门槛了吗?...
  11. 会议OA之我的会议(排座送审)
  12. 维谛技术(Vertiv):一切研发创新都以客户需求为核心
  13. amazon 云平台入门
  14. 计算机曝光模式有哪些,曝光模式_拍摄技巧_太平洋电脑网PConline
  15. 最后教一次:完美解决电脑上的流氓软件
  16. 个人日记-电影《夏日友晴天》观后感-2021-08-25
  17. 计算机系统概述 —— 硬件系统
  18. xss漏洞-DVWA跨站攻击盗取用户cookie值
  19. Android中免root的hook框架学习——whale(二)实战hook java方法
  20. no suitable kits found

热门文章

  1. java毕业设计——基于JSP+sqlserver的高校智能排课系统设计与实现(毕业论文+程序源码)——高校智能排课系统
  2. dapper mysql 预处理_.Net Core中Dapper的使用详解
  3. Python三角函数公式计算
  4. 动图解析,自由泳最容易出现的5个错误动作
  5. 【js正则表达式】小数点保留两位的js正则表达式
  6. Office 2010卸载工具(来自微软官方)
  7. MathType的标尺栏与公式对齐
  8. 计算机组成原理EMAR啥意思,计算机组成原理第十讲(组合逻辑控制器).ppt
  9. 服务器Dec 24 05:35:13 iZ94w9irr4pZ CRON[13855]: pam_unix(cron:session): session closed for user root De
  10. flywa报错Detected resolved migration not applied to database: 20221103.10000